Data Processing --------------- SeaCat salinity is prone to error due to a mismatch of conductivity and temperature response times, especially when the descent rate is non-uniform. Such errors are likely to be larger than calibration errors. SeaCat salinity errors are expected to be as high as 0.05 units in areas of high gradients. For these data the descent rate was very noisy for a few casts in the middle part of the cruise, but quite steady for most casts and temperature and salinity gradients were not extreme, so the error is likely much smaller than that. Salinity calibration sampling was done but no analysis results could be found at the time of processing. Post-cruise calibration results for salinity suggest that salinity calibration is well within +/- 0.002. There was no dissolved oxygen calibration for this cruise. Dissolved oxygen saturation at the surface suggests that the oxygen sensor might have been reading a little low. Based on a previous cruise the SBE DO data were recalibrated by multiplying by 1.04.
